Darkroom Supplies: HC-110 Deveolper ChemistryNegative quality is similar to that produced with Kodak Developer D-76 but with shorter development times. Highly active. Extremely versatile; easy-to-use liquid concentrate. Can be used in both replenished and non-replenished systems.
